Definitions:

Blank Indorsement

An endorsement on a financial instrument, such as a check, that specifies no endorsee, making it payable to the bearer.

Trust

A fiduciary relationship in which one party, known as a trustor, gives another party, the trustee, the right to hold title to property or assets for the benefit of a third party, the beneficiary.

Deposit Only

A restriction placed on a bank account, indicating that the funds can only be deposited and cannot be directly withdrawn or used for other transactions.

Restrictive Endorsements

Limiting conditions or instructions written on the back of negotiable instruments, like checks, controlling their use or further transfer.
